🪰 A team of researchers has unveiled the complete connectome of a male fruit fly central nervous system—a seamless map of all the neurons in the brain and nerve cord of a single male fruit fly and the millions of connections between them.

The Genetically-ENcoded Indicator and Effector (GENIE) project at the Janelia Research Campus of HHMI has the organization, multidisciplinary know-how, and technology to greatly accelerate optimization of protein sensors for observing biological function.
